#include using namespace std; int main() { int n; cin >> n; set st; for (int i = 0; i < n; ++i) { int t; cin >> t; st.insert(t); } vector vt; adjacent_difference(st.begin(), st.end(), back_inserter(vt)); cout << *min_element(vt.begin() + 1, vt.end()) << endl; return 0; }